The aim of this study was to assess the relationship between the EuroQol 5-dimension 5-level (EQ-5D-5L) visual analogue scale (VAS) and index scores, clinical characteristics, and outcomes in patients with HF and the effect of dapagliflozin on these scores. METHODS AND RESULTS: We performed a patient-level pooled analysis of the DAPA-HF and DELIVER trials, which investigated the effectiveness and safety of dapagliflozin in patients with HF and reduced ejection fraction (HFrEF) and mildly reduced/preserved ejection fraction (HFmrEF/HFpEF), respectively. Patients reporting higher (better) EQ-5D-5L VAS and index scores had a lower prevalence of comorbidities, including atrial fibrillation and hypertension, than patients with a worse score. They were also more likely to have better investigator-reported (New York Heart Association class) and patient-self-reported (Kansas City Cardiomyopathy Questionnaire) health status and lower median N-terminal pro-B-type natriuretic peptide levels. Compared to patients with the lowest scores (Q1), those with higher EQ-5D-5L VAS scores had better outcomes: the hazard ratio for the composite of cardiovascular death or worsening HF was 0.81 (95% confidence interval 0.72-0.91) in Q2, 0.74 (0.65-0.84) in Q3, and 0.62 (0.54-0.72) in Q4. The risk of each component of the composite outcome, and all-cause death, was also lower in patients with better scores. Similar findings were observed for the index score. Treatment with dapagliflozin improved both EQ-5D-5L VAS and index scores across the range of ejection fraction. CONCLUSIONS: Both higher (better) EQ-5D-5L VAS and index scores were associated with better outcomes. Dapagliflozin treatment improved EQ-5D-5L VAS and index scores, irrespective of ejection fraction.","journal":"European Journal of Heart Failure","year":2024,"id":432976,"datarank":0.0,"base_score":0.0,"endowment":0.0,"self_citation_contribution":0.0,"citation_network_contribution":0.0,"self_endowment_contribution":0.0,"citer_contribution":0.0,"corpus_percentile":null,"corpus_rank":null,"citation_count":14,"citer_count":0,"citers_with_citation_signal":0,"citers_with_endowment":0,"datacite_reuse_total":0,"is_dataset":false,"is_dataset_confidence":0.9567,"is_data_producer":false,"deposit_databanks":null,"is_oa":true,"file_count":0,"downloads":0,"has_version_chain":false,"published_date":"2024-01-01","fair_score":null,"fair_percentile":null,"algorithm_id":"datarank_citation_only_1hop_v6","ranking_scope":"data_only","authors":[{"id":859434,"name":"Toru Kondo","orcid":"0000-0001-6853-7574","position":1,"is_corresponding":false},{"id":1237924,"name":"Atefeh Talebi","orcid":"0000-0002-8144-9074","position":2,"is_corresponding":false},{"id":57280,"name":"Pardeep S.
